Line Street: Relict of the War of 1812
When: Saturday, September 21st 2024, 2 p.m. - 3 p.m.
Where: Main Library, 68 Calhoun Street, 29401
The name and location of Charleston's Line Street represent vestiges of a line of fortifications erected hastily in 1814–15 to defend the city against an expected British attack. Join CCPL's historian, Dr. Nic Butler, for an illustrated overview of the rise and fall of Charleston's military preparations during the War of 1812.
